What Do You Need?

Before you start looking for a new property, you need to think about the things you want from your next home.

This is an important step, as it will help you narrow down your search. Thinking about this will also speed things up if you ever decide to work with an affordable housing association.

Note that if you’re in a difficult situation, you should really just focus on the non-negotiables.

For instance, if you have children, you might need a certain number of bedrooms. Or, if you work in a certain location, you might need a home that isn’t too far from your job.

Approach Housing Associations

As alluded to earlier, housing associations can help you in this situation.

These associations manage a selection of houses, and they offer these homes to people that need affordable housing. These homes tend to have lower rents when compared to other properties of a similar nature.

If you work with an agency that offers affordable housing services, you might be ‘means-tested.’ This process is designed to ensure that only those most in need can benefit from the assistance on offer.

You can find a housing association by Googling the term ‘housing assistance‘ alongside the name of your chosen area.

If this approach doesn’t deliver any good results, you might want to try a different search string such as ‘affordable housing near me.’

Change Location

In some cases, you may find that a particular location is simply too expensive for you.

If this happens, you may want to consider moving to a completely new area. This can be a difficult thing to do, but it might be your only option given your current financial situation.

If you’re looking to move to a new state, you can use a website like Zillow to find the cheapest areas in your chosen location.

It’s worth remembering that the property you move into doesn’t have to be your permanent home. That’s because after a year or so, your circumstances might change, and you may then be able to move into a ‘better’ home.
